Don spent $2.36 for 22 stamps. If he bought only 10 cent stamps and 12 cent stamps, how many of each kind did he buy ?

So for this problem I went through multiples of 12 that ended in 6, because that's the only way that you would get a 6 at the end of the total. With that I found that he would have to buy 8 of 12 cent stamps and the rest (14) ten cents stamps.

The radius of the circle is 7 inches what is the approximate length of AB (AB is 135 degrees
Sholpan [36]
We know that
circumference=2*pi*r
for r=7 in
circumference=2*pi*7------> 14*pi in

if 360° (full circle)  has a length of------------ 14*pi in
 135°-----------------------------> x
x=135*14*pi/360----------> x=5.25*pi in--------> 16.49 in

the answer is
5.25*pi in  or 16.49 in
